Watermarking and Steganography
Steganalysis and Watermarking
Researchers: Ismail Avcibas, Hamza Ozer, Ahmet Bastug,
Bulent Sankur
Description: We have developed schemes for the automatic
detection of the presence of hidden messages (the steganalysis
problem) in image and audio documents. We have also investigated the
contribution of error correcting codes in enhancing the data hiding capacity of
images.
Hash function
Researchers: Hamza
Ozer, Baris Coskun, Bulent Sankur
Description: Robust hash functions, focused on content of
the document, for both audio and video documents, are developed. The hash
output can be used both for database searching purposes as well as watermarking
and authentication check.

Intrusion Detection
Researchers: E. Anarım,
M.O. Depren, M. Topallar,
K. Ciliz.
Description:
We introduce a
hybrid Intrusion Detection System (IDS) architecture utilizing both anomaly and
misuse detection approaches. The proposed anomaly detection module uses
Self-Organizing Map (SOM)
structure to model normal behavior. The misuse detection module uses J.48 decision tree
algorithm to classify various types of attacks. A rule-based Decision Support System (DSS) is
developed for interpreting the results of both anomaly and misuse detection
modules.

Cryptoanalysis
Researchers:
Emin Anarim, İmran Ergüler
Description: We first show that combination of Oechslin’s method with the rainbow chain model for block
ciphers and Biryukov’s method of applying
pre-computed tables on stream ciphers improves in time-memory trade off. We
also propose a new pre-computation table, which can solve the difficulties
encountered by an attacker that faces difficulties whenever the stream
generator changes its present state in an irregular manner, for example clock
controlled generators. Our proposed
solution is based on a new pre-computation table for the case where the number
of different initial states yielding the same internal state at some time in
future and the same output sequence is very likely to be a very small integer.
